【安服/渗透测试面试问题总结】教程文章相关的互联网学习教程文章

关于C / STL / C#/ J2SE的最佳和最短书籍,以准备工作面试/测试

我是一名拥有10年商业经验的软件开发人员,我对几乎所有命令式语言都感到满意.但我意识到,大多数雇主不喜欢能够提供优质软件的候选人,而是那些接受过培训的人,他们会回答诸如“C中指针和引用之间的十个差异”或“这个混乱的代码片段将打印的内容”之类的问题.上次我15年前在中学读过一本关于C的书,是的,那就是Bjarne Stroustrup.但是今天我需要一些快速的东西,没有关于多态性等的长期哲学解释,而是专注于愚蠢的访谈测试.那么,你能推...

测试开发面试准备之python selenium API【代码】

一、浏览器操作 1、浏览器最大化driver.maximize_window() #将浏览器最大化显示2、设置浏览器宽、高driver.set_window_size(480, 800)#设置浏览器宽480、高800显示3、控制浏览器前进、后退driver.back()#浏览器后退 driver.forward()#浏览器前进二、简单对象的定位 webdriver 提供了一系列的元素定位方法,常用的有以下几种: id name class name tag name link text partial link text xpath css selector分别对应python w...

测试工程师的一些面试题目(python)

http://www.mamicode.com/info-detail-2399086.html 有一个列表,每个元素存放学生姓名、成绩,按学生成绩从优到差排序。 stu=[张三:20,李四:70,王五:88,李六:40,赵琦:55.5]def sortscore(A): for j in range(len(A)): for i in range(len(A)-1): if A[i].split(:)[1] < A[i+1].split(:)[1]: A[i],A[i+1] = A[i+1],A[i] i=i+1 else: i=i+1 j...

python测试开发面试题【代码】

试卷时间 60分钟,请不要在试卷上作答,用A4纸做答题纸作答。 一,中文单项选择题(30分,每个3分) 1.下列哪个语句在Python中是非法的? A、x = y = z = 1 B、x = (y = z + 1) C、x, y = y, x D、x += y 2.关于Python内存管理,下列说法错误的是 A、变量不必事先声明 B、变量无须先创建和赋值而直接使用 C、变量无须指定类型 D、可以使用del释放资源 3、下面哪个不是...

Python 测试开发算法面试题【代码】

二分查找算法: #coding=utf-8def binary_search(num_list,x):'''二分查找'''num_list=sorted(num_list)left,right = 0,len(num_list)while left <right:mid = int((left + right)/2) #获取中间的值得indexif num_list[mid] > x:right = midelif num_list[mid] < x:left = mid+1else:return '待查元素{0}在列表中下标位:{1}'.format(x,mid)return '待查找元素%s不存在指定列表中'%xif __name__ =='__main__':num_list = [11,22,34,...

金三银四季!测试一下Java 面试题,能答对60%就去BAT~~~【图】

2019,相对往年我们会发现今年猎头电话少了,大部分企业年终奖缩水,加薪幅度也不如往年,选择好offer就要趁早,现在开始准备吧,刷一波Java面试题,能回答70%就去BATJTMD大胆试试~ 以下是2018年发布过的Java面试真题、BATJ等各大互联网公司的面试真经,为方便大家查看,特意做了个导航集合(见文末)。 一、面试真题 涵盖内容:Java常考题目、JVM、多线程、MySQL、Redis、Kafka、Docker、RocketMQ、Nginx、MQ队列、数据结构、并发...

面试题:使用存储过程造10w条测试数据,数据库插入10w条不同数据【代码】【图】

前言 面试题:如何造10w条测试数据,如何在数据库插入10w条数据,数据不重复? 想面试高级测试、高级自动化测试、测试开发岗位,面试时候考察 SQL 就不是简单的增删改查的,必然会问到存储过程。 一问到存储过程基本上是送命题了,本篇讲解下如何使用存储过程在 mysql 数据库快速造大量测试数据。 存储过程基本语法 MySQL 5.0 版本开始支持存储过程。存储过程(Stored Procedure)是一种在数据库中存储复杂程序,以便外部程序调用的...

面试题:如何造10w条测试数据,在数据库插入10w条不同数据

前言 面试题:如果造10w条测试数据,如何在数据库插入10w条数据,数据不重复 最近面试经常会问到sql相关的问题,在数据库中造测试数据是平常工作中经常会用到的场景,一般做压力测试,性能测试也需在数据库中先准备测试数据。那么如何批量生成大量的测试数据呢? 由于平常用python较多,所以想到用python先生成sql,再执行sql往数据库插入数据。 使用语言:python 3.6 插入数据 首先我要插入的 SQL 语句,需每条 id 不重复 ,下面是...

测试面试必会sql(1)【图】

测试一般各种查询语句用的较多,下面的查询语句都是需要熟悉的 Course表Score表Student表 Teacher表1,查询课程编号为“02”的总成绩 SELECT * FROM `Score` where c_id=02; 2,查询课程编号为“01”的课程比“02”的课程成绩高的所有学生的学号 SELECT st.*,a.s_core,b.s_coreFROM Student stINNER JOIN (SELECT s_id,s_core from Score where c_id=01) a ON st.s_id=a.s_idINNER JOIN (SELECT s_id,s_core FROM Score WHE...

软件测试(测试开发)面试题总结(一)Linux命令篇

软件测试面试题总结(一)Linux命令篇 总结博主面试时候遇到的一些面试题。视情况更新。 身份:2021届应届毕业生。 岗位:软件测试工程师,软件测试开发工程师 面试公司:网易(面的最多,只报过网易有道,但是后续网易游戏、网易云音乐都找我面试了很多次,未拿到offer)、bilibili、一些上海互联网公司、一些北京公司。 按心情写答案。答案太长的不写,度娘上都有的。 常用linux命令 Linux常用命令: ls ll ls -l (列出目录下的...

面试官:APP自动化测试关键点在哪里?(功能测试开始解析)【图】

首先问大家一个问题,做APP测试它的关键点在哪里? APP测试的关键,如果你去面试的一家公司主要业务是做一个app测试,他肯定会问你一个问题:你如何去做APP测试? 那我们就从app测试的关键去分析。 大家可以想一想app测试的关键点有哪些? 脑海中应该马上能想到很多专业的测试技术,首先就是一个app功能,这个是毫无疑问的,不管你是做web端还是做app还是做小程序等等。首先功能你把它全部测试好,这个其实和我们的web测试以及其他...

安全测试面试

安全测试攻击? 固定会话攻击、crlf注入(过滤\r回车、\n换行)、host头攻击(修改host头)、rsync未授权访问、跨站脚本攻击(xss、页面对特特殊字符、脚本过滤或转义)、跨站请求伪造(校验referer\token)、用户枚举(统一身份验证失败时的响应,如:用户名或密码错误)、不安全的http方法、

面试——测试用例设计【图】

面试——测试用例设计 一、淘宝购物车测试用例设计二、用户登录场景的用例设计三、设计图片的测试用例四、文件上传的测试用例五、微博发动态测试用例六、对一台自动售货机进行测试用例设计七、设计微信发红包测试用例八、设计抖音直播功能测试用例九、如何对一个接口编写测试用例一、淘宝购物车测试用例设计 1 功能测试: 购物车是否可以添加商品购物车的优惠券是否可以使用购物车的计算结果是否正确如果使用购物券购物车里面的价格...

全套软件测试面试笔试题(附答案)【图】

一、判断题 1.软件测试的目的是尽可能多的找出软件的缺陷。(Y) 2.Beta测试是验收测试的一种。(Y) 3.验收测试是由最终用户来实施的。(N) 4.项目立项前测试人员不需要提交任何工件。(Y) 5.单元测试能发现约80%的软件缺陷。(Y) 6.代码评审是检查源代码是否达到模块设计的要求。(N) 7.自底向上集成需要测试员编写驱动程序。(Y) 8.负载测试是验证要检验的系统的能力最高能达到什么程度。(N) 9.测试人员要坚持原则,缺陷未修复完坚决不予...

软件测试基础------面试【图】

公司的流程 首先立项确定项目,产品处一个出产品说明书,需求人员编写需求文档,需求评审,开发编写详细设计,测试编写测试用例, 测试用例评审,开发进行编码,测试部署环境进行测试,主要功能业务实现后,进行冒烟测试,然后进行功能测试,出现bug使 用禅道进行记录跟踪,然后开发进行修改,测试进行验证,然后进入回归测试,接着是验收测试,验收测试通过后,进行上线。 软件的应用场景 游戏性测试,金融性测试...